# Reviewer notes — env file for the Tumblewick laundry-locker access flow.
# Quick context: residents tap their fob, the gateway asks our service for a
# one-time locker code, and the Dryloft controller pops the door. Most of
# these values are boring (timeouts, locker bank IDs, retry counts), so skim
# those. The part worth your attention is the new code-minting path — it now
# signs each locker code instead of using the old shared PIN table. That
# signing step depends on the secret set on the line below:

env line for fafof-fahag: LEDGER_TOKEN5=f8790

# Break-Glass Access: Tracewarden

If Tracewarden goes dark and you can't follow requests across the Pellwick microservices, don't panic — break-glass exists for exactly this. First, confirm with the on-call lead that normal auth is actually down, not just slow. Then grab the sealed break-glass bundle from the Coldstone vault share. It unlocks the admin trace console across all services, bypassing SSO. Everything you do is logged and reviewed afterward. To open the bundle, enter the recovery passphrase shown below.

unlock words, tawif-tahop: oliys-ulawyn-tamdor-lamys-casox-jormir-fraius-kasath-ulador-ulamir-holir-sorys-holeth

## Runbook: Canary Gating Rules

For the weekly sync: Driftgate canaries promote automatically only when error rate stays under 0.5% and p95 latency within 10% of baseline for 30 minutes. Any manual override must be logged in the gating table with a reason. Rollbacks reset the observation window. Gate decisions and override history are stored in the deploy-metrics database; query it using the connection string below.

primary connection of hadup-kajeg = clickhouse://rusath_svc:lTa6pgZ@db-a477.plorvaforge.corp:5432/oliox

### Action Item 7 — Plugin timeout contract

The Gradewheel timetable solver killed third-party constraint plugins without warning during the incident. We will publish a formal timeout contract: plugins get 200ms per constraint pass, with a graceful cancellation signal first. Plugin authors must handle cancellation by the next release. The draft contract and migration notes are posted on the internal spec page.

operations page: https://confluence.tolvaqsys.corp/spaces/pages/pages/6e787158f507